About This Item

SAN FRANCISCO: HARTLEY STUDIO, 1947. 1st Edition 1st Printing. Soft cover. Near Fine/Very Good. 8vo - over 7¾ - 9¾" tall. 13 Pp. 1947. LIMITIED EDITION # 85 OF 500 COPIES SIGNED BY ARTIST ON LIMITATION PAGE. EIGHT SATIRICAL DRAWINGS WITH ORIGINAL COLOR WASHES BY RUSSELL HARTLEY. DESCRIPTION: HEAVY WEIGHT SOFT COVER MANILA PAPER WITH BROWN STAMPED TITLE/COAT OF ARMS ON COVER, SATIRICAL BIOGRAPHIES IN LEAD PAGES TO (8) LOOSE LEAF ORIGINAL COLOR WASH PLATES OF HENRY VIII AND HIS WIVES, WITH A LIGHT BROWN SOFT COVER WITH BLACK STAMPED TITLE AND COAT OF ARMS ON COVER. DIMENSIONS: 9" x 10 5/8 x 9"." BOOK CONDITION: NEAR FINE; TINY CHIP OF FRONT COVER AT AT LOWER RIGHT CORNER. OUTER COVER: VERY GOOD; LIGHT SOILING AT OUTER EXTREMITIES, LIGHT WEAR AT EDGES, 7/16" TEAR AT CROWN HEEL FOLD, 1/2" TEAR AT LOWER LEAF CORNER.
